Established in 1951, IOM is the leading inter-governmental organization in the field of migration and works closely with governmental, intergovernmental and non-governmental partners. IOM is dedicated to promoting humane and orderly migration for the benefit of all. It does so by providing services and advice to governments and migrants.

Context:
Under the direct supervision of the CCCM National Officer, in close coordination with Sub Office management, and technical guidance of the Monitoring and Evaluation Officer, the successful candidate will assist with information management, data quality checking, data gathering and analysis, documentation, reporting, and community feedback mechanism (CFM) of IOM’s programmes implemented by the CCCM unit across the country..

Core Functions / Responsibilities:

1.    Support the implementation of IM , M&E and reporting activities across the programme, according to the programme goals and objectives across CCCM, while elevating issues to the National Officer for corrective measures.
2.    Assist with planning and monitoring of data collection and analysis activities; Ensure data collection and analysis is performed and reported in a timely manner, within budgets and as per calendar of activities.
3.    Support the relevant units to document the process and activities of on-going projects such as capturing case stories for donor reports and other products.
4.    Support the TPM as directed by the M&E Officer, including in the development and implementation of tools, liaison with teams on the ground, schedule.
5.    Ensure the SMT is completed monthly across all sites, to a high standard and on time. Check site profile graphics and circulate the site profiles on a monthly basis.
6.    Ensure timely reporting of the Internal Bi-Weekly SitRep and ExU Bi-Weekly SitRep for Marib base.
7.    Support all hubs with the Project Indicator Reporting Tools
8.    Ensure quality data entry and timely completion of the event tracker, CFW database, CFM database, site residency database, and population movement trackers.
9.    Ensure all activities documentation been uploaded to OneDrive
10.    Any other duties as required.
